我正在设计一个使用Python和RESTful的Flask应用程序接口。正如预期的那样,如果一切顺利,API需要接收API请求并返回数据,但在出现错误的情况下,它需要温和地失败并返回适当的错误。当出现错误时,我通常会引发异常,但在这种情况下,我需要向用户返回错误消息(try-catch块?)。我目前处理错误的方法是让我的函数同时返回数据和错误,并在每个级别检查数据,最后将数据或错误返回给API函数的调用者。None:
return None, "could n
下面是我的异常的堆栈跟踪Attempting refresh to obtain initial access_token
The API call app_identity_service.GetAccessToken/python27_lib/versions/1/google/appengine/api/app_identity/app_identity.py", line 589, in get